I was staying with a friend in Scotland at the weekend and watched hurling. So they were playing at Croke Park and the pitch is 144 metres long by 80 metres wide. The game finished 32-32 after 20 minutes extra time making 90 plus injury in total. But when play breaks down the Sliotar (ball) gets whacked 100 metres up the pitch in a moment. Ref has no chance to keep up. That said they did have goal line technology which helps and guys behind both posts as well.

 

Entertaining, but not replacing the beautiful game anytime soon.
